#3b8cc0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b8cc0 is composed of 23.1% red, 54.9%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.3% cyan, 27.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 203.5 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 49.2%. #3b8cc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#001981.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#3b8cc0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04090c is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b8cc0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757f86 is the less saturated color, while #0199fa is the most saturated one.
